Publicité
+ Répondre à la discussion
Affichage des résultats 1 à 3 sur 3
  1. #1
    Membre du Club
    Inscrit en
    décembre 2005
    Messages
    217
    Détails du profil
    Informations forums :
    Inscription : décembre 2005
    Messages : 217
    Points : 65
    Points
    65

    Par défaut ORM vs OODB vs EJB vs JDO vs JPA !

    Bonjour à tous.

    Dans le cadre du développement d' une application wed (en intranet) reposant sur une base de donnée (coeur du problème), pour une entreprise, j'aimerais avoir vos avis quant aux choix de la technique à mettre en oeuvre pour developper cette application.

    Je souhaite développer en java, mais ce n'est pas un choix définitif ! En tous cas je désire FORTEMENT dévelloper avec un langage Orienté Objet et surtout surtout avec un " concepte" base de donnée OO (db4o par example) ou ORM/RDBMS(Hibernate par example) !

    J' aimerais avoir vos avis sur la question, et que vous éclairiez ma lanterne aux sujet des EJB, JDO et JPA car je n' ais pas bien compris leurs fonctionnalités et si ils peuvent être appliquer à mon logiciel.

    PS: Je pense avoir compris l' intérêt des OODBMS et ORM/RDBMS mais je ne voudrais pas passer à côté des autres technologies disponibles (EJB, JDO et JPA ) !

    Je ne sais pas si je me suis bien fais comprendre, n'hesitez pas à me demander.

    Cordialement.

  2. #2
    Expert Confirmé
    Inscrit en
    août 2008
    Messages
    2 147
    Détails du profil
    Informations forums :
    Inscription : août 2008
    Messages : 2 147
    Points : 3 746
    Points
    3 746

    Par défaut

    C'est pas du tout le bon forum pour parler de ces technos...
    Même si c'est "Autres SGBD", c'est un sous-forum de Base de Données donc RELATIONNELLES où les intervenants ont généralement une approche base de données épaisses.

    Sinon les SGBD OO étaient sensés révolutionner l'informatique mais c'est un gros flop, personne n'utilise ça !
    Si l'entreprise cliente est un gros compte aucune chance de vendre un SGBD OO...

    Les EJB sont aussi plus ou moins mort, en tout cas de nombreuses critiques existent et la techno n'est plus à la mode !

    Au moins les ORM avec Hibernate par exemple sont à la mode.
    Je ne connais pas, mais de ce que j'en ai lu, je pense qu'il est difficile de se lancer dans un projet hibernate sans aucune connaissance du sujet car ça rajoute une couche de complexité qu'il faudra maîtriser.

    Si c'est un gros projet avec forte volumétrie et concurrence d'accès ça me semble très compliqué d'utiliser hibernate sans compétance, s'il n'y a pas d'enjeu majeur et que c'est un projet pour se faire la main pourquoi pas...

    Mais de toute façon, un projet très exigeant niveau volumétrie et concurrence d'accès nécessite forcément de l'expertise sur les différentes technos, SGBDR inclus et plutôt deux fos qu'une !

  3. #3
    Membre du Club
    Inscrit en
    décembre 2005
    Messages
    217
    Détails du profil
    Informations forums :
    Inscription : décembre 2005
    Messages : 217
    Points : 65
    Points
    65

    Par défaut

    ok je repose ma question sur les RDBMS;

Liens sociaux

Règles de messages

  • Vous ne pouvez pas créer de nouvelles discussions
  • Vous ne pouvez pas envoyer des réponses
  • Vous ne pouvez pas envoyer des pièces jointes
  • Vous ne pouvez pas modifier vos messages
  •